A classroom that celebrates different cultures promotes which outcome?

Explanation:
Celebrating different cultures in the classroom builds inclusion and belonging because students see their own backgrounds reflected in what they learn and how they interact, and they feel safe, valued, and invited to participate. When diverse holidays, traditions, languages, and viewpoints are shared, relationships strengthen, stereotypes fade, and collaboration grows, helping every student engage more deeply with the material and with peers. This creates a classroom climate where everyone feels they belong and can contribute. In contrast, emphasizing competition can create rivalries, isolation can occur when differences are ignored, and uniformity can erase identities. Celebrating culture directly supports the feeling of inclusion and belonging.
